The lottery system in India has become an integral part of local culture and entertainment. Various states across the country organize their own lottery draws, providing opportunities for people to try their luck and potentially win substantial prizes.
In India, lottery results are typically announced on specific dates and times, with draws conducted under strict government supervision to ensure fairness and transparency. Local lottery products in India include state-run lotteries like Kerala Lottery, Punjab Lottery, and Maharashtra Lottery. These government-regulated lotteries contribute significantly to state revenues while providing entertainment to millions of Indians. The tickets are affordable and easily accessible through authorized retailers across various states.
When checking lottery results, participants can visit official state lottery websites, check newspapers, or visit authorized lottery retailers. The winning numbers are displayed publicly, and prize claims must be made within specified timeframes following the draw announcement. |
